All About

Living in Vance, AL

A small town located in Alabama, Vance has a population of just under 2,000. Families with young children are a common sight, as kids under 5 account for an above-average 9% of the population, though young professionals are also well-represented. At an average age of just over 33, the town's population is notably younger than most cities in Alabama. Only 23% of residents rent in Vance, as most own their homes. The average rent of $863/month is a bit above the state average.

Vance has an average commute time of about 27 minutes. Driving a vehicle is the most common mode of getting to work, selected by 48% of residents, while public transportation isn't used. Walking isn't a common way to get to work.

There are two primary industries in Vance: manufacturing and retail. Combined, these industries account for 20% of the labor force in the town. Meanwhile, looking at job function, 12% of residents work in transportation, which ranks as the top field in the town. With an average annual income of about $70,000, Vance workers take home around $9,000 more than the average Alabama resident. However, Vance's average income is just about on par with the national average of $73,345. Compared to the national average, Vance has a large number of residents over the age of 25 with a high school degree or equivalent (25%). Further, 10% possess a Bachelor's, Master's, Professional, or Doctoral degree.
